# Load the TensorFlow model
model_path = 'saved_model' # Replace with your TensorFlow model path
model = tf.saved_model.load(model_path)
# Placeholder values for input dimensions
input_width = 640 # Replace with the actual input width of your model
input_height = 640 # Replace with the actual input height of your model
def predict_with_tf_model(image):
# Preprocess the image
image = cv2.resize(image, (input_width, input_height))
image = np.expand_dims(image, axis=0)
image = image / 255.0
# Run inference
output = model(image)
# Post-process the output if needed
return output
